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 615030 11392330 7158
19021 6918 311746086
19021 6918 311746086
8953731727 0489920618 97233882267 966
All about undefined
Interested in learning more?
19021 6918 311746086
8953731727 0489920618 97233882267 966
See more
3024709 1037230311
98941064221 44 333
See more
2999 94233 427078
0569158 99328 757
See more